QuestionFollowing the close of the voting, where are the votes first sorted and counted?
Answer: a. The polling stations
Réponses Immediately after the close of the poll, the presiding officer shall, in the presence of such of the candidates or their representatives and their polling agents as are present, proceed to count, at that polling station, the ballot papers of that station and record the votes cast in favour of each candidate or question. Constitution, art. 49

QuestionUnder what conditions are ballots recounted?
Réponses d. By request
Réponses A candidate or a representative of a candidate or a counting agent may, if present when the counting of the ballots is completed, request the presiding officer to (a) recount the ballots; and (b) again recount the ballots for a second time. Public Elections Regulations
